Comfort, controls and sound that target long listening days

One of the biggest daily pain points with in ear headphones is comfort over long stretches. Sony is leaning on a more compact design and softer tips so you can keep the WF-1000XM5 in during back to back meetings, flights or long study sessions without constant readjustment.

Touch controls and auto mode switching target the reality of your day, not a lab scenario. The goal is to move from a noisy subway car to a quiet office, then to a windy street, without digging into menus. When it works, it feels almost invisible, which is exactly the point.

Sound quality is tuned to stay engaging at lower volumes, which matters if you want to protect your hearing but still enjoy detail and punch. Many users coming from older Sony models or generic buds should notice tighter bass and clearer vocals right away.

Sony WF-1000XM5 key facts at a glance

Manufacturer: Sony

Category: True wireless noise cancelling earbuds (new release)

Price: 299.99 USD

Availability: In stock at major retailers and online

Highlights: Advanced noise cancelling, improved comfort, adaptive sound control, all day battery with case charging
